GUITAR & HARP

Ken grew up loving the music coming from a musically gifted family from both his father's and mother's side.  He began playing guitar at age 12 picking up the electric years later. This is in addition to the years he devoted to the harmonica. His job at Bethlehem Steel then offered a generous amount of down time to balance out the  painstaking work involved.

Despite the mill's loud, harsh working conditions,  Ken  managed to hear the soulful sounds of his harp just enough to embrace it musically. Although his roots may have come from country and bluegrass styles, Ken   followed the moving, unique sounds he saw in

his rock and blues influences.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

INFLUENCES:  Joe Walsh Frank Zappa, Eric

 Clapton, Jimmie Page, Leslie West.
